Bengaluru: The Karnataka Examinations’ Authority (KEA) has decided to go ahead with the first round of the ‘Option Entry’ process for engineering, veterinary, agriculture, physiotherapy, and allied health science courses, although the agency is yet to receive the seat matrix for medical and dental courses.

ADVERTISEMENT

The concerned government departments for medical, dental, Ayurveda, Homeopathy, Unani, nursing, architecture, Yoga and Naturopathy courses are yet to share their respective seat matrix with the KEA. “Once they submit the seat matrix for their respective programmes, we will commence the Option Entry process for all those courses as well,” said KEA Executive Director H Prasanna.

Meanwhile, aspirants for the other programmes have till July 15 to enter their choice of colleges in the first round. Results of the ‘Mock Allotment’, based on the choices entered by the students, will be published on July 19. Subsequently, students will be provided time till July 22 to rearrange their respective list of preferred colleges. KEA will publish the final list of Allotted Seats on July 25.

Students have been asked to go through the Seat Matrix thoroughly before entering their preferences. They have also been asked to go through the instructions in the ‘UGCET-2025 Seat Allotment’ information brochure before and while entering their options. Students can also watch videos uploaded on the ‘KEA Vikasana’ YouTube channel for guidance. Candidates for Veterinary Science, Animal Husbandry, and Agricultural Sciences, who have secured practical ranks, must enter their options separately for both practical and regular seats.
